Maps, Pravin & Gigaba walk into a bar. Here's what whiskey we'd pour them
We've prescribed the perfect sips for various public figures
Pravin Gordhan, former Minister of Finance
Whiskey: Three Ships 15-Year-Old Pinotage Cask Finish
Why it's a suitable sip: Like Gordhan, this astounding expression has given South Africa international credibility, and is universally lauded for its complex charm. It’s a world first, patriotically finished in pinotage casks and imbued with an earthy, wine-soaked sweetness — the perfect dram to help you deal with all that crap at work.
Maps Maponyane, presenter and entrepreneur
Whiskey: Chivas Regal Ultis
Why it's a suitable sip: One of the most approachable A-listers around, Maponyane naturally exudes Chivas Regal’s commitment to shared successes. He also effortlessly balances a diverse range of personal pursuits, accomplishments, and talents, and is perfectly paired with Ultis and its impeccable blend of five hand-selected signature single malts.
Chad le Clos, swimmer
Whiskey: Kilchoman Machir Bay
Why it's a suitable sip: He caused a stir at a very young age, as has Islay upstart Kilchoman by releasing an abundance of highly acclaimed expressions since its inception in 2005. Machir Bay is the most iconic of the lot and, like le Clos, has received loads of awards for a fresh, brazen style that’s hard to ignore.
